返回课件首页 第二章数控加工程序的编制 第一节数控编程的基本知识 编程的内容与步骤 数控编程的过程可以用流程图2-1表示。各环节简要 说明如下: 确定 编写制备程 加工艺 方案处 数学处 程序控制 清单 介质 理理 序检验 图2-1数控编程过程
第二章 数控加工程序的编制 确 定 加 工 方案 工 艺 处 理 数 学 处 理 编 写 程 序 清单 制 备 控 制 介质 程 序 检 验 第一节 数控编程的基本知识 一、 编程的内容与步骤 数控编程的过程可以用流程图2-1表示。各环节简要 说明如下: 图2-1 数控编程过程 返回课件首页
1.确定加工方案 选择能够实现该方案的适当的机床、刀具、夹具和 装夹方法。 2.工艺处理 工艺处理包括选择对刀点,确定加工路线和切 削用量 3.数学处理 数学处理的主要任务就是根据图纸数据求出编 程所需的数据。 4.编写程序清单 5.制备介质和程序检验
1. 确定加工方案 选择能够实现该方案的适当的机床、刀具、夹具和 装夹方法。 2. 工艺处理 工艺处理包括选择对刀点,确定加工路线和切 削用量。 3. 数学处理 数学处理的主要任务就是根据图纸数据求出编 程所需的数据。 4. 编写程序清单 5. 制备介质和程序检验
编程方法 编程方法有手工编程、数控语言编程和图形编程三种 手工编程 2.数控语言编程 3.图形编程 数控加工工艺基础 数控机床的坐标系 在数控机床中,为了实现零件的加工,往往需要控制几 个方向的运动,这就需要建立坐标系,以便区别不同运 动方向。为了使编出的程序在不同厂家生产的同类机床 上有互换性,必须统一规定数控机床的坐标方向。我国 的JB3051-82标准为《数字控制机床坐标轴和运动方向 的命名》,其中的规定与国际标准|S0841中的规定是 相同的
一、 编程方法 编程方法有手工编程、数控语言编程和图形编程三种 1. 手工编程 2. 数控语言编程 3. 图形编程 二、 数控加工工艺基础 1. 数控机床的坐标系 在数控机床中,为了实现零件的加工,往往需要控制几 个方向的运动,这就需要建立坐标系,以便区别不同运 动方向。为了使编出的程序在不同厂家生产的同类机床 上有互换性,必须统一规定数控机床的坐标方向。我国 的JB3051-82标准为《数字控制机床坐标轴和运动方向 的命名》 ,其中的规定与国际标准ISO841中的规定是 相同的
宋(d SAt(S 末静璃弹左!就(b 义独的落坐和蔑阵 图22数控机床坐标系的定义
图2-2 数控机床坐标系的定义
2.机床坐标系、编程坐标系和局部坐标系 G54中的 局部坐标系 编程坐标 系G54 G59中的 局部坐标系 编程坐标 系G59 机床坐标系 图2-3机床坐标系、编程坐标系和局部坐标系的关系
编程坐标 系G54 编程坐标 系G59 G54中的 局部坐标系 G59中的 局部坐标系 机床坐标系 2. 机床坐标系、编程坐标系和局部坐标系 图2-3 机床坐标系、编程坐标系和局部坐标系的关系
对刀点的确定 对刀点也称起刀点是数控加工中刀具相对工件运 动的起点 ZO XO a)对称零件的对刀点选择b)钻孔加工时的对刀点选择 图2-4对刀点的选择
2. 对刀点的确定 对刀点也称起刀点是数控加工中刀具相对工件运 动的起点。 a)对称零件的对刀点选择 b)钻孔加工时的对刀点选择 图2-4 对刀点的选择
4.编程中的误差控制 (1)逼近误差 (2)插补误差 (3)圆整化误差
4. 编程中的误差控制 (1) 逼近误差 (2) 插补误差 (3) 圆整化误差
第二节手工编程 G代码 常用的G指令有: 1.快速点定位指令G00 格式为:G00X-Y 种可能的路径:
第二节 手工编程 一、 G代码 常用的G指令有: 1. 快速点定位指令G00 格式为: G00 X— Y—; 三种可能的路径:
A a)方案1 b)方案2 c)方案3 图25G00指令的运动轨迹
A A A B B B X X X Y Y Y a)方案1 b)方案2 c)方案3 图2-5 G00指令的运动轨迹
直线插补指令G01 格式:G01X-Y-F 圆弧插补指令G02、G03 格式:G0O2(G03)X-Y-1-J-F-; A a)逆圆指令G03 b)顺圆指令G02 图2-6圆弧插补指令
1. 直线插补指令G01 格式: G01 X— Y— F—; 2 圆弧插补指令G02、G03 格式:G02(G03)X— Y— I— J— F—; a)逆圆指令G03 b)顺圆指令G02 图2-6 圆弧插补指令